Karachi: July 31, 2010. (PCP) In recent polls conducted by Pakistan Christian Post PCP, 99% of Pakistani Christians voted demanding resignation of Federal Minority Minister Shahbaz Bhatti on his failure to protect life and property of minorities in Pakistan.
9141 voted for his resignation while only 111 wanted him to stay in his post which was only 1% ever lowest approval rate for Shahbaz Bhatti, according to PCP polls.
Shahbaz Bhatti was nominated by Pakistan Peoples Party PPP government as Federal Minister for Minorities while he was selected as Member National Assembly of Pakistan by PPP on reserved seats for minorities.
Shahbaz Bhatti always demanded selection of minorities on reserved seats in parliament instead of election by votes of minorities and used same back door of selection when President General Parvez Musharraf snatched right of direct votes in 2002, national general elections on intimation of Islamic parties to capture Christian vote bank.
The incident of violence against Christians and other religious minorities have risen up to 200% during PPP and PML(N) government in Pakistan and particularly in Punjab province of Pakistan while Shahbaz Bhatti acted to promote government policies and never came to rescue victims of violence that justice may be ensured.
The sad incidents of killing of blasphemy accused in broad day light, attacks on innocent Christians, destroying of Christian homes, Desecration of Churches, gang rape of Christian women and enforced conversion and burning alive Christians happened in Pakistan during this regime.
Dr. Nazir s Bhatti, President of Pakistan Christian Congress PCC, said in a statement issued here today that Shahbaz Bhatti must resign now if he listens voice of Pakistani Christians through these polls.
“I condemn incident of destroying homes of Christians by Muslim extremists in village Korian and burning alive of seven Christians in Gojra on this day in year 2009” said Nazir Bhatti
Pakistan Christian Congress PCC have organized a protest meeting on August 2, 2010, in Washington DC to mark anniversary of Gojra massacre and killing of Christian Brothers in Faisalabad on July 19, 2010.
Nazir Bhatti added “PCC demands repeal of blasphemy law in Pakistan and shall make important announcements on August 2, 2010, in DC Conference by PCC”
